              Fatima wins gold at World Transplant Games despite kidney transplant!

              Fatima Rashid, a Bangladeshi kidney recipient living in Dubai, won gold in javelin throwing and bronze in 200-meter running at the World Transplant Games. Organ donors and recipients participated in this international sports event, celebrating life through sports. Fatima showed through her own experience that kidney transplantation does not mean the end of life, but rather opens the way to fulfilling dreams

              There will be no Games 'Village' in the next Asiad!

              The host country of Asian Games-2026 is Japan. Thousands of athletes from 45 countries will participate in it. However, this time the country has decided not to build a games village to accommodate players, coaches, support staff, officials from different countries. They are going to make alternative arrangements to accommodate the players.

              After the World Cup, another international tournament moved from Dhaka

              The Commonwealth Karate Championship was scheduled to be held in Dhaka on September 25-29 with the participation of 40 countries. The venue of that championship changed in the context of the overall situation in Bangladesh. Instead of Dhaka, Bangladesh, the tournament will now be held in Durban, South Africa.

              bangladesh also defeated Malaysia by a big margin

              Bangladesh won the second consecutive victory in the Bangabandhu Cup International Kabaddi Tournament. The hosts defeated Malaysia by 73-22 points with 6 goals in the match held at Mirpur Shaheed Suhrawardy Indoor Stadium. Bangladesh was leading by 37-04 points in the first half.
